After reaching the AFC Divisional Round, the Ravens have their work cut out for them in building their 2025 roster as they look to get over their postseason woes and build a team that can cross the threshold and into the Super Bowl.
Currently, the Ravens sit at $10.54 million in cap space, with $7.5 million in “effective cap space,” according to overthecap.com. It won’t be easy to navigate free agency when they have the seventh-lowest amount of cap space. It will also be a challenge as the Ravens have a few of their key players as free agents, and other teams are showing interest in them.
